About P. Santhoshkumar

P. Santhoshkumar is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, Materials Chemistry and Polymers and Plastics, having authored 69 papers that have together received 1.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advancements in Battery Materials (44 papers), Supercapacitor Materials and Fabrication (41 papers), Advanced Battery Materials and Technologies (22 papers), Advanced battery technologies research (14 papers),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(10 papers), Electrocatalysts for Energy Conversion (8 papers), Advanced Battery Technologies Research (4 papers) and Conducting polymers and applications (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(999 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(1.5k citations),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(359 citations), Automotive Engineering (220 citations) and Electrochemistry (87 citations). P. Santhoshkumar has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, India and United Arab Emirates. Frequent co-authors include Chang Woo Lee, Hyun‐Seok Kim, Dhanasekaran Vikraman, K. Karuppasamy, K. Prasanna, Yong Nam Jo, Murugan Nanthagopal, Suk Hyun Kang, Nitheesha Shaji and Sajjad Hussain.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Alloys and Compounds, Applied Surface Science, Journal of Industrial and Engineering Chemistry, Ceramics International and International Journal of Energy Research.
